Exactly. I too was shocked when I learned the real, full story. However, in the spirit of hisorical accuracy: estimates are that somewhere in the range of 95% of the deaths were inadvertant, and due to the indtroduction of diseases that they had no immunity to...independantly of the wars, displacement, and diseased blankets. BTW, the diseased blankets were the policy of a handful of players, and not the official policy of the government.

I DO have some sympathy for the American Indians though, and I DO acknowledge that Europeans came here as a conquering population. History is largely written by the winner/survivor, and even then, the narrative has an unexplained 'break' between the first chapters filled with helpful natives that literally saved the colonists asses...and the later chapters where the natives are the 'problem'.

To balance things out, it should be noted that hostile conquest was the dominant theme throughout much of history, in all cultures, and the Indians frequently went to war with one another; the Europeans just happened to be more advanced and better organized. I support the reservation casinos and other such measures recognizing that the Indians were subjugated (flat out Un-American), they were stripped of THEIR land (they didn't have a deed...so fucking what, it was still theirs), and their culture was destroyed (also Un-American) and the decent and fair thing to do at this point in history is to extend an olive branch with the realization that "What goes around, comes around." I feel no guilt simply because I was not around and had absolutely nothing to do with that period of history: just as I don't feel entitled to anything else I was born into and I can only work with what I have.

It's ironic that Americans [and I am an American] complain about other countries taking jobs and resources and disrupting the 'American' way of life considering that's exactly what happened to the original inhabitants of this land: karma is a motherfucker. But that's just an aside. America is the driving force of developement in the world at this point, and will be so for a very long time.

I will say this much: Thank you to the first colonists for coming to America, and a warm thanks to the American Indians who made their very survival possible. I hope this debate eventually concludes with the realization that life is hard and peope did terrible things to each other, so I'm in favor of putting the past to rest as best as possible.
